Email Marketing: What You Need to Know

An increasing number of companies are turning to email as an alternative to traditional direct mail marketing, recognizing the power of this medium as a low-cost, high-value communication channel. This trend is a natural outcome of the proliferation of email itself. Ten years ago few people had email addresses; today, few do not. Most people have integrated email into their personal and professional lives. Studies show that many people check their email both day and night, thanks to the proliferation of mobile devices. In AOL's most recent "email addiction" survey, 59% of people emailing from portable devices admitted to using them in bed, in their pajamas! 
 With this kind of penetration into peoples' lives, email is an excellent tool for establishing and maintaining customer relationships. Success in business is all about creating customer loyalty and driving repeat business. The value of customer loyalty is too compelling to ignore, since acquiring a new customer is much more expensive than selling to an existing customer. Customer loyalty is a function of trust, and that trust is best established through ongoing, consistent communication.
